Perched on the edge of the Atlantic Ocean, The Twelve Apostles Hotel and Spa is a luxurious hotel that offers breathtaking views and a golf course nearby. The hotel features elegant rooms and suites with modern amenities and views of the ocean or Table Mountain. Golf enthusiasts can enjoy a round of golf at the nearby Clovelly Country Club, which offers a scenic course with stunning views of the coastline. After a day on the greens, guests can relax at the hotel's spa or savor a delicious meal at one of the on-site restaurants.